Property Overview
Nestled in, yet conveniently located, this meticulously cared for home sits in a coveted upper westside neighborhood, better known as Nobel. Designed by notable architectural firm Thatcher & Thompson, this is the model home for the Westmont development. Upon entering youre greeted by vaulted ceilings, hardwood floors and an inviting, cozy gas fireplace. The home has been meticulously cared for with pride of ownership evident around every corner. The garage space has been converted with an elegant double-door entrance, unique to the development, providing flex opportunities for a lounge room, home office, or simply for additional storage. Close to the UCSC main entrance, University Terrace Park, and Moore Creek Preserve, the location provides access to some of the best that Santa Cruz has to offer. The lushly landscaped back patio enhances the sense of privacy and creates a sheltered garden feel, ideal for outdoor relaxation or quiet work. Private parking and an efficient layout support both work-from-home and comfortable small-household living. Residents of the development also enjoy access to a private pool, BBQ area, private alley, and riparian open spaceamenities that add to the communitys charm and year-round usability.
